About the role
Senior Full Stack Software Engineer
Skydio is the leading US drone company and the world leader in autonomous flight, the key technology for the future of drones and aerial mobility. The Skydio team combines deep expertise in artificial intelligence, best-in-class hardware and software product development, operational excellence, and customer obsession to empower a broader, more diverse audience of drone users, from utility inspectors to first responders, soldiers in battlefield scenarios, and beyond.
About The Role
Skydio’s mission is to make the world a safer and more efficient place through the use of autonomous drones. Our customers—from public safety agencies to industrial and enterprise operators—deploy fleets ranging from a single drone to tens of thousands of drones and docking stations to support critical missions such as infrastructure inspection, emergency response, search and rescue, and large-scale mapping.
As a Senior Full Stack Software Engineer you will design and build the core cloud and geospatial systems that power autonomous drone operations at scale. Your work will enable customers to plan complex aerial missions, manage and monitor large fleets, visualize rich spatial data, and seamlessly integrate drone operations into their workflows.
You’ll develop primarily on Skydio Cloud (our SaaS platform), with occasional work on software that runs directly on the drone. This is a true full-stack role, combining backend systems in Python and Go with TypeScript and React on the frontend. You will collaborate closely with Autonomy, Backend Infrastructure, Product, Design, and Field teams, owning technical direction and features end-to-end while helping shape Skydio’s long-term platform architecture.
How You’ll Make An Impact
- Continually design and expand Skydio Cloud’s core data model and API for drones/docks and the data they produce. See our public API to see what’s possible.
- Build the core features of our customer facing web app, for example: over the air updates, real-time fleet health, photo and video asset management, security and permissioning, user and device management, and 3D reconstruction.
- Collaborate across functions (product managers, designers, engineers, and support) to design and deliver Skydio Cloud features that enable customers to scale.
- Design secure, efficient, observable, scalable, and robust software for dealing with petabytes of real-time data and video from fleets of Skydio drones.
- Leverage your experience and best practices to not only uphold but improve Skydio’s engineering standards. From code review to post-mortems, you’ll be expected to help the team grow.
- Ensure Skydio’s platform is available 24/7 by joining in the rotating on-call schedule across all engineering teams. While reliability is critical, our platform is stable and incidents are rare—Crime never sleeps, but thankfully, you still can.
